REIGs resemble small mutual funds that buy rental homes. In a normal realty investment group, a business buys or builds a set of home blocks or apartments, then allows investors to acquire them through the business, therefore signing up with the group. A single investor can own one or multiple units of self-contained living area, however the company running the investment group jointly manages all of the systems, managing upkeep, marketing vacancies, and talking to renters.
A basic realty financial investment group lease is in the financier's name, and all of the systems pool a part of the rent to defend against occasional jobs. To this end, you'll get some income even if your system is empty. As long as the vacancy rate for the pooled systems doesn't surge expensive, there You can find out more need to be sufficient to cover costs.

REITs are purchased and offered on the major exchanges, like any other stock. A corporation must payment 90% of its taxable earnings in the kind of dividends in order to keep its REIT status. By doing this, REITs avoid paying corporate income tax, whereas a regular company would be taxed on its profits and after that have to decide whether or not to disperse its after-tax revenues as dividends.
In contrast to the previously mentioned types of real estate investment, REITs afford financiers entry into nonresidential investments, such as shopping malls or office complex, that are normally not feasible for individual investors to purchase straight. More crucial, REITs are highly liquid because http://rowanzrng202.jigsy.com/entries/general/more-about-what-is-reo-in-real-estate they are exchange-traded. In other words, you won't require a realtor and a title transfer to assist you cash out your financial investment.
Lastly, when looking at REITs, investors must distinguish in between equity REITs that own buildings, and mortgage REITs that supply financing for genuine estate and dabble in mortgage-backed securities (MBS). Both deal direct exposure to real estate, however the nature of the direct exposure is different. An equity REIT is more traditional, because it represents ownership in realty, whereas the home loan REITs focus on the income from mortgage funding of property.

There are Residential, Commercial, Industrial, and Land. Our focus will be on property and commercial realty since those are the most typical classifications for beginning investors. Residential real estate is what the majority of individuals are familiar with. It's where you buy a residence. Buying a single or multifamily home, and leasing it out is the most typical type of property genuine estate investing.
Commercial Real Estate is businesses or homes with more than 4 systems. If you wish to invest in a restaurant, for circumstances, that would be thought about industrial real estate.Whether an apartment building has fifty units or 4 systems, it's all considered Business Realty. If it has three units or less, it's categorized as domestic property.
